如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Python 2.6:回顾经典版本的魅力与应用

Python 2.6:回顾经典版本的魅力与应用

Python 2.6 是 Python 编程语言的一个重要版本,于 2008 年 10 月 1 日发布。作为 Python 2 系列的最后一个主要版本,Python 2.6 在当时引入了许多新功能和改进,同时也为 Python 3 的过渡做好了准备。让我们来回顾一下这个经典版本的特点、应用以及它在编程历史中的地位。

Python 2.6 的新特性

Python 2.6 引入了一些重要的新特性和改进:

  1. 模块和库的更新:许多标准库模块得到了更新和改进,例如 json 模块的引入,使得 JSON 数据的处理变得更加方便。

  2. 语法改进:虽然 Python 2.6 主要是为 Python 3 做准备,但它也引入了一些语法上的改进,如 with 语句的改进,使得资源管理更加简洁。

  3. 性能优化:在 Python 2.6 中,许多内部实现得到了优化,提高了整体性能。

  4. 警告系统:为了帮助开发者更好地过渡到 Python 3,Python 2.6 引入了 DeprecationWarningPendingDeprecationWarning,提醒开发者某些功能将在未来版本中被移除。

Python 2.6 的应用领域

尽管 Python 2.6 已经不再是主流版本,但它在某些领域仍然有其独特的应用:

  1. 科学计算:在科学计算领域,许多早期的库和工具仍然依赖于 Python 2.6。例如,NumPy 和 SciPy 在早期版本中对 Python 2.6 的支持非常好。

  2. 系统管理和自动化:许多系统管理员和运维人员使用 Python 2.6 来编写脚本,进行系统管理和自动化任务。

  3. 教育和培训:在一些教育机构中,Python 2.6 仍然被用作教学工具,因为它包含了许多基础概念和语法,适合初学者学习。

  4. 遗留系统:一些企业和组织的遗留系统仍然运行在 Python 2.6 上,这些系统可能涉及到关键业务流程,迁移到新版本需要大量的时间和资源。

Python 2.6 的历史地位

Python 2.6 在 Python 语言发展史上具有重要地位:

  • 过渡版本:它是 Python 2 向 Python 3 过渡的桥梁,提供了许多兼容性改进和警告系统,帮助开发者平滑过渡。

  • 稳定性和兼容性Python 2.6 提供了很好的稳定性和向后兼容性,使得许多项目能够在很长一段时间内继续使用它。

  • 社区支持:尽管官方支持已经结束,但社区仍然为 Python 2.6 提供了大量的资源和支持。

Python 2.6 的未来

虽然 Python 2.6 已经不再是主流版本,但它在历史上的贡献不可磨灭。随着 Python 3 的普及,越来越多的项目和库已经迁移到新版本。然而,对于一些特定的应用场景和遗留系统,Python 2.6 仍然有其存在的价值。

Python 2.6 不仅是一个版本,更是一种编程文化的象征。它代表了 Python 语言在发展过程中对稳定性、兼容性和用户体验的重视。即使在今天,了解 Python 2.6 仍然有助于我们更好地理解 Python 语言的发展脉络和设计哲学。

总之,Python 2.6 作为一个经典版本,值得我们回顾和学习。它不仅在技术上为 Python 3 的发展铺平了道路,更在社区中留下了深刻的印记。希望通过这篇文章,大家能对 Python 2.6 有一个全面的了解,并从中汲取到一些编程的智慧。